Our Realtor called yesterday to let me know he had talked with the selling agent and had a few of our questions answered. We are in the number one position (great news). Since we put in the same offer as the one that the bank was already working on, the sellers had to submit a change of name form and that was supposed to have happened yesterday. Essentially it allows the same "sale" to go through instead of having to start the whole process over. When that form was submitted, the listing agent was going to change the MLS status to "pending" to discourage other offers. There is only one loan on the house, through Wells Fargo Bank, and the BPO has been completed, although we're not sure when.
